Barry Douglas disagrees with fan claiming Leeds need eight wins for promotion
Leeds United defender Barry Douglas has disagreed with a fan claiming that the Whites need eight wins out of 10 to earn promotion to the Premier League this season.
The Scotsman claimed that Leeds will need and want to win every single one of their remaining 10 games in the Championship after brushing Hull aside on Saturday.
Leeds currently have a five-point gap to Fulham in third-place, and a win against the Cottagers would mean that they only need to win six of their eight games to secure automatic promotion.
Marcelo Bielsa will be drilling his side to win every single game, and it appears his squad have responded in exactly the right manner.
Replying to a fan on his recent Instagram post on Saturday, Douglas claimed that Leeds will need to win each one of their remaining games.
“Wrong, we need 10,” he responded.
Many Leeds fans responded to Douglas, with the majority loving his response after the commanding 4-0 win at the KCOM.
It has been another frustrating season for the former Wolves man at Elland Road, with yet another campaign that has been littered by injuries halting his progress in West Yorkshire.
Should Leeds earn promotion back to the Premier League, Douglas might not be here to experience it with Football Insider reporting that the Whites could look to sell the full-back at the end of the season.
